I can also only log in using a proxy that pretends to be in the US. Login from Germany fails.

Folks, this IP based banning is outright stupid. It does not stop hackers, rather regular users. And no, whitelisting IPs is not an option either because as anyone should know, consumer contracts have a forced 24h disconnect in many parts of the world so that the IP isn't static.

Instead of doing this security snakeoil, finally slapping Let's Encrypt (it's free!) on the forum is long overdue. Anyone can read the login passwords over http, you know. Any hotspot or hotel operator for example. This is 2020!

And if really necessary, a session based captcha would also be acceptable.
